Victoria University College. Extravaganza "KYD". 3rd, 5th and 6th May, 1930

Cast of Caricatures

Cast of Caricatures.

(In order of their appearance—or nearly so.)

"These Savages, who want all Manner of Regard and Deference to the rest of Mankind, come only to show themselves to us, without any other Purpose than to let us know they despise us."The Spectator.

Granose (a Fairy) Agnes Elliott

"Child, if you have a-rummy kind of name,
Remember to be thankful for the same."

Belloc.

Aspidistris (Private Secretary to Quinina) Ola Nielsen

"Then Nature said, 'A lovelier flower
On earth was never sown.'"

Wordsworth

.

Pigfern H. J. Bishop
Scabious A. A. B. Mouat

Constables of the Ward Island Fairy Service.

"What is this life, if, full of care,
We have no time to stand and stare?"

—Davies.

"The Police have their faults, but thank God they're inefficient!"—Chesterton.

Quinina (the Fairy Queen) Aileen Davidson

"She was bora to make hash of men's buzzums." —Artemus Ward.

Fairiel (a fairy problem) Edna Purdie

"I think it was the best of luck
That I was born a little duck."

—The Fairy Ring

.

Monkey Shine Nuts from the Family U. Williams
Monkey Brand Tree J. A. Whitcombe

"What has posterity done for us'?"—Trumbull.

One-eyed Jake (a sinful old pirate) H. C. Read

"He drinks with impunity, or anybody who invites him."—Artemus Ward.

Sunkist Sammy (a pirate's apprentice) R. Hogg

"Call us not weeds—we are flowers of the sea."—Aveline.

Captain Kyd, Scourge of the Scuppers (a coarse corsair). A. D. Priestley

"There are few ways in which a man can be more innocently employed than in getting money."—Doctor Johnson.

"The pleasantness of an employment does not always evince its propriety."—Jane Austen.

Pimpernickel, Queen of the Undieworld (a piratess). Zenocrate Henderson

"Lor', but women's rum cattle to deal with
The first man found that to his cost—
Arid I reckon it's just through a woman
The last man on earth will be lost."

—Sims.

Rose-petal Rufus (a bad pirate) W. S. Harris

"He'd wash his hands in blood to keep them clean."—E. B. Browning.

Blowfly Bert (a badder pirate) R. Larkyn

"I drink, I huff, I strut, look big and stare,
And all this I can do, because I dare."

—Villiers.

Little Eric of Berhampore (offsider to Kyd) D. G. Edwards

"A noisy man is always in the right."—Cowper.

Ben Borstal (a music pirate) H. W. Dowling

"The great Burlybumbo who sings double D."—Barham.

Sherlock Holmes (a sleuth) W. J. Mountjoy

"There is a passion for hunting something deeply implanted in the human heart."—Dickens.

Dr. Watson (his shadow) W. P. Rollings

"You look wise. Pray correct that error."—Lamb.
